TPC for Women ages 21 to 35

At The Philanthropy Connection, we are deeply committed to fostering the next generation of women philanthropists. We welcome and encourage adults for whom woman is a meaningful identifier between the ages of 21 and 35 to join TPC, and have designed three distinct pathways to best correspond with varied lives and goals of prospective members!

Our Young Philanthropist Members

Our Young Philanthropists, also known as “YPs,” are an essential pillar of our membership! A “YP” is simply a general member who has joined TPC and is between the ages of 21 and 35.  These members love learning, connecting, and showing up when inspiration strikes, but without commitment. Being a general YP member allows for exploration of opportunities without taking on new responsibilities.

Our YP Accelerator Program

TPC recognizes that some women want to take a deeper dive into the world of philanthropy and professional development. Our YP Accelerator Program is perfect for women seeking new experiences that will help them grow their skillset, gain meaningful opportunities to collaborate with others, and have a role in creating impact that is felt within the Massachusetts community and beyond. This is a one-year program designed for women who appreciate structured support while developing or expanding their careers.

Our Fellowship Program

The Fellowship Program provides YPs with the highest level of engagement, and is best for women seeking structure, leadership development, and a long-term path to grow their influence. Fellows are motivated by the opportunity to lead grant teams, serve on committees or take on critical projects, and participate in shaping the organization’s future. This two-year program is the right fit for budding philanthropists seeking a more intensive, multi-year commitment that aligns with long-range professional goals.

Whether a prospective YP chooses to pursue general membership, the YP Accelerator Program, or the Fellows Program, they are in good hands at TPC!

TPC’s YP programming has been trailblazing from the start, as it was the first women’s collective giving organization in the United States to establish its Fellows program. Today, almost a third of all TPC members are YPs! Between 2020-2024, we had two YPs serve as Co-President! In addition, young women hold a sizable number of leadership positions on the Board, and as Grant Team leaders. Historically, YPs have also led the charge on strategic initiatives including our robust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ion efforts.
